Full-time research assistant

Kansas State University is seeking a Full-Time Research Assistant to support research for Dr. Maria Diehl in the Psychological Sciences Department. The role involves assisting with experimental projects, maintaining lab records, handling research animals, and performing tissue processing and data collection.

Responsibilities

Help with experimental projects
Assist with ordering supplies
Maintaining updated inventory and lab records
Shares duties with other lab members to handle and care for research animals
Run behavioral experiments
Collect data
Maintain an organized research lab
Assist with tissue processing
Performing tissue assays
Taking microscope pictures
